Come rendere il sito più veloce: guida pratica 2026

Aggiornato il:
4/5/26
Web Design

La velocità di caricamento di un sito web rappresenta uno dei fattori più critici per il successo di qualsiasi progetto digitale. Un sito lento non solo frustra gli utenti, ma danneggia anche il posizionamento sui motori di ricerca e riduce drasticamente le conversioni. Secondo recenti studi, oltre il 53% degli utenti abbandona un sito se impiega più di tre secondi a caricarsi. Comprendere come rendere il sito più veloce diventa quindi essenziale per qualsiasi attività che voglia competere efficacemente online nel 2026.

Perché la velocità del sito è fondamentale

La velocità di caricamento influenza direttamente tre aspetti chiave del business digitale. Primo, l'esperienza utente: i visitatori si aspettano risposte immediate e un sito lento li spinge verso i competitor. Secondo, il posizionamento SEO: Google utilizza la velocità come fattore di ranking dal 2018, e con i Core Web Vitals questo peso è aumentato significativamente. Terzo, le conversioni: ogni secondo di ritardo può ridurre le conversioni fino al 7%.

Dal punto di vista psicologico, la percezione della velocità conta quanto la velocità reale. Gli utenti formano un'opinione sul sito nei primi 50 millisecondi, e un caricamento lento crea immediatamente una percezione negativa del brand. Questa prima impressione influenza tutto il percorso successivo dell'utente sul sito.

L'impatto economico delle performance

Le performance scadenti hanno conseguenze economiche concrete. Un e-commerce che fattura 100.000 euro al giorno può perdere 2,5 milioni di euro all'anno con un solo secondo di ritardo nel caricamento. Per le piccole e medie imprese, anche miglioramenti apparentemente marginali nella velocità possono tradursi in aumenti significativi dei lead e delle vendite.

Misurare la velocità attuale del sito

Prima di ottimizzare, è fondamentale misurare. Gli strumenti principali per analizzare le performance includono Google PageSpeed Insights, GTmetrix, WebPageTest e Lighthouse. Ciascuno offre metriche specifiche che aiutano a identificare i colli di bottiglia.

Le metriche essenziali da monitorare:

  • First Contentful Paint (FCP): tempo prima che il primo contenuto appaia
  • Largest Contentful Paint (LCP): quando l'elemento principale diventa visibile
  • Time to Interactive (TTI): quando la pagina diventa completamente interattiva
  • Cumulative Layout Shift (CLS): stabilità visiva durante il caricamento
  • Total Blocking Time (TBT): tempo in cui la pagina non risponde agli input

Ogni metrica racconta una parte della storia delle performance. L'LCP dovrebbe idealmente rimanere sotto i 2,5 secondi, mentre il CLS dovrebbe essere inferiore a 0,1. Comprendere questi valori aiuta a stabilire priorità nell'ottimizzazione.

Core Web Vitals metrics dashboard

Strumenti di analisi avanzata

Oltre ai tool di base, strumenti come Chrome DevTools consentono di analizzare il waterfall delle risorse, identificando quali file rallentano il caricamento. La Network tab mostra dimensioni, tempi di download e ordine di caricamento di ogni risorsa. La Performance tab permette di registrare e analizzare l'intero processo di rendering della pagina.

Ottimizzazione delle immagini

Le immagini rappresentano spesso il 50-70% del peso totale di una pagina web. Secondo analisi dettagliate sulle cause comuni di un sito lento, questo è uno dei fattori più impattanti sulle performance.

Strategie di ottimizzazione immagini:

  1. Scegliere il formato corretto (WebP per foto, SVG per loghi e icone)
  2. Comprimere senza perdita eccessiva di qualità
  3. Implementare lazy loading per immagini below the fold
  4. Utilizzare dimensioni responsive con srcset
  5. Servire immagini tramite CDN

La conversione al formato WebP può ridurre le dimensioni del 25-35% rispetto a JPEG senza perdita visibile di qualità. Per i browser che non supportano WebP, implementare un fallback a JPEG tramite il tag picture garantisce compatibilità universale.

Lazy loading e caricamento progressivo

Il lazy loading carica le immagini solo quando stanno per entrare nel viewport. Questa tecnica riduce drasticamente il tempo di caricamento iniziale e il consumo di banda. Nel 2026, tutti i browser moderni supportano nativamente l'attributo loading="lazy", rendendo l'implementazione semplice e immediata.

Ottimizzazione del codice e delle risorse

Minimizzare e comprimere HTML, CSS e JavaScript è essenziale per rendere il sito più veloce. La rimozione di spazi, commenti e caratteri non necessari può ridurre le dimensioni dei file del 20-40%.

Tecniche di ottimizzazione del codice:

  • Minificare tutti i file CSS e JavaScript
  • Rimuovere codice inutilizzato (CSS e JS morti)
  • Combinare file multipli quando possibile
  • Implementare code splitting per JavaScript
  • Differire il caricamento di script non critici

Il caricamento asincrono e differito degli script previene il blocco del rendering. Gli script marcati con async vengono scaricati in parallelo e eseguiti appena pronti, mentre quelli con defer vengono eseguiti dopo il parsing HTML. Questa distinzione è cruciale per ottimizzare l'ordine di caricamento.

CSS critico e rendering path

Estrarre il CSS critico necessario per il rendering above-the-fold e incorporarlo inline nell'HTML accelera significativamente il First Contentful Paint. Il resto del CSS può essere caricato in modo asincrono, migliorando il tempo percepito di caricamento anche se il tempo totale rimane simile.

Caching e delivery delle risorse

Il caching è una delle strategie più efficaci per migliorare le performance. Configurare correttamente gli header di cache permette ai browser di memorizzare risorse statiche, eliminando download ripetuti nelle visite successive.

Livelli di caching:

  • Browser cache per risorse statiche
  • Server-side cache per contenuti dinamici
  • CDN cache per distribuzione geografica
  • Object cache per query database
  • Page cache per HTML pre-generato

Una strategia di cache ben implementata può ridurre i tempi di caricamento del 70-90% per gli utenti di ritorno. Gli header Cache-Control e ETag gestiscono validazione e scadenza delle risorse, mentre una CDN distribuisce i contenuti geograficamente vicino agli utenti finali.

Ottimizzazione del server e dell'hosting

La qualità dell'hosting influenza profondamente le performance. Un server condiviso economico può sembrare conveniente, ma i tempi di risposta lenti vanificano qualsiasi ottimizzazione frontend. Investire in hosting di qualità rappresenta la base per un sito veloce.

Fattori di performance server-side:

  1. Tempo di risposta del server (TTFB)
  2. Risorse hardware (CPU, RAM, storage SSD)
  3. Configurazione software (PHP, database)
  4. Prossimità geografica del server
  5. Qualità della connessione di rete

Il Time to First Byte dovrebbe idealmente rimanere sotto i 200 millisecondi. Server troppo carichi o configurati male possono facilmente superare il secondo, rendendo inutili tutte le altre ottimizzazioni. La scelta tra hosting condiviso, VPS, cloud o dedicato dipende dal traffico e dalle risorse necessarie.

Database e query optimization

Per siti dinamici, l'ottimizzazione del database è critica. Query inefficienti possono rallentare drasticamente il tempo di generazione della pagina. Indicizzare correttamente le tabelle, limitare le query per pagina, utilizzare caching per query ripetute e ottimizzare la struttura del database sono interventi che possono ridurre i tempi di risposta del 50-80%.

Website optimization workflow

HTTP/2, HTTP/3 e protocolli moderni

I protocolli di rete moderni offrono vantaggi significativi rispetto a HTTP/1.1. HTTP/2 supporta multiplexing, permettendo download paralleli di multiple risorse su una singola connessione. HTTP/3, basato su QUIC, migliora ulteriormente le performance su connessioni mobili instabili.

Passare a HTTP/2 o HTTP/3 richiede un certificato SSL/TLS (HTTPS) e supporto server. La maggior parte degli hosting moderni offre questo supporto nativamente. I benefici includono riduzione della latenza, gestione più efficiente delle connessioni e migliore utilizzo della banda disponibile.

Ottimizzazione per dispositivi mobili

Nel 2026, oltre il 65% del traffico web proviene da dispositivi mobili. Come rendere il sito più veloce su mobile richiede attenzioni specifiche: connessioni più lente, processori meno potenti e schermi più piccoli richiedono approcci dedicati.

Strategie mobile-first:

  • Implementare design responsive ottimizzato
  • Ridurre ulteriormente dimensioni immagini per mobile
  • Minimizzare JavaScript pesante
  • Testare su connessioni 3G/4G simulate
  • Utilizzare AMP per contenuti critici (opzionale)

Il mobile-first indexing di Google significa che la versione mobile del sito determina il ranking. Un sito lento su mobile danneggia il posizionamento generale, non solo nelle ricerche da smartphone. Testare regolarmente su dispositivi reali, non solo in emulazione, rivela problemi che gli strumenti automatici potrebbero non rilevare.

WordPress e CMS: ottimizzazioni specifiche

WordPress alimenta oltre il 43% del web, ma configurazioni non ottimizzate possono renderlo lento. La scelta di temi leggeri, limitazione dei plugin, ottimizzazione del database e implementazione di caching sono essenziali.

Per chi gestisce un sito web aziendale strategico, WordPress ben ottimizzato può offrire performance eccellenti. Plugin di caching come WP Rocket o W3 Total Cache, combined con ottimizzazione immagini via ShortPixel o Imagify, trasformano un'installazione lenta in un sito performante.

Plugin essenziali per performance WordPress:

  • Plugin di caching (WP Rocket, W3 Total Cache)
  • Ottimizzazione immagini (ShortPixel, Imagify)
  • Lazy loading (se non nativo nel tema)
  • Minificazione e combinazione asset
  • Database cleanup

Limitare il numero di plugin installati è cruciale. Ogni plugin aggiunge query database, script e stili che rallentano il sito. Valutare se ogni funzionalità giustifica l'impatto sulle performance aiuta a mantenere il sito snello.

Ottimizzazione database WordPress

WordPress accumula revisioni, spam, transient scaduti e dati orfani. Plugin come WP-Optimize puliscono il database automaticamente, riducendo dimensioni e migliorando velocità query. Schedulare pulizie settimanali mantiene il database efficiente nel tempo.

Monitoraggio continuo e manutenzione

Ottimizzare la velocità non è un'attività una tantum. Plugin, temi e contenuti nuovi possono introdurre regressioni. Implementare strategie di monitoraggio continuo garantisce che le performance rimangano ottimali.

Sistema di monitoraggio efficace:

  1. Controlli automatici settimanali con PageSpeed Insights
  2. Real User Monitoring (RUM) per dati utenti reali
  3. Alert per degradazione performance oltre soglie definite
  4. Review mensile delle metriche Core Web Vitals
  5. Testing dopo ogni aggiornamento significativo

Tools come Google Search Console mostrano i Core Web Vitals per le pagine reali, non solo in laboratorio. Questi dati rivelano problemi che gli utenti effettivamente sperimentano. Confrontare metriche lab e field identifica discrepanze tra ambiente di test e condizioni reali.

Font web e tipografia performante

I font personalizzati aggiungono personalità ma possono rallentare significativamente il rendering. Ogni famiglia di font con multiple varianti (regular, bold, italic) richiede download separati. Limitare a 2-3 varianti e utilizzare font-display: swap previene il blocco del rendering in attesa dei font.

Font variabili rappresentano un'innovazione significativa: un singolo file contiene multiple varianti di peso e stile, riducendo drasticamente il numero di richieste. Google Fonts e altri servizi offrono sempre più font variabili ottimizzati per il web.

Preloading e font subsetting

Il preloading dei font critici con <link rel="preload"> li carica anticipatamente, riducendo il flash di testo non stilizzato. Il subsetting, che include solo i caratteri effettivamente utilizzati, può ridurre le dimensioni dei file font del 70-90% per siti in lingue occidentali.

Third-party scripts e dipendenze esterne

Script di terze parti (analytics, social media, chat, ads) sono spesso i maggiori rallentatori. Ogni script esterno introduce latenza, richieste aggiuntive e potenziali blocchi. Valutare criticamente quali strumenti sono realmente necessari può migliorare drasticamente le performance.

Gestione script terze parti:

  • Caricare script in modo asincrono o differito
  • Utilizzare tag manager per controllo centralizzato
  • Implementare consent management per GDPR
  • Considerare alternative self-hosted quando possibile
  • Monitorare l'impatto di ciascuno script

Google Tag Manager permette di gestire centralmente tutti gli script, riducendo il numero di modifiche dirette al codice. Tuttavia, configurazioni GTM eccessive possono diventare esse stesse un collo di bottiglia. Mantenere container snelli e ben organizzati è essenziale.

Compressione e ottimizzazione delle risorse

La compressione GZIP o Brotli riduce le dimensioni di trasferimento del 70-90% per file testuali. Brotli, supportato da tutti i browser moderni, offre compressione superiore a GZIP con miglior rapporto qualità-velocità. La maggior parte dei server moderni supporta entrambi, selezionando automaticamente quello ottimale in base al browser.

Altri suggerimenti per migliorare i tempi di risposta del server includono abilitazione di HTTP/2 server push per risorse critiche, ottimizzazione configurazione server web (Apache, Nginx) e utilizzo di tecnologie moderne come LiteSpeed.

JavaScript frameworks e bundle size

I framework JavaScript moderni (React, Vue, Angular) offrono potenti funzionalità ma possono generare bundle molto pesanti. Tecniche come code splitting, tree shaking e lazy loading dei componenti mantengono le dimensioni sotto controllo.

Per progetti che non richiedono interattività complessa, considerare approcci più leggeri o vanilla JavaScript può migliorare drasticamente le performance. Ogni kilobyte di JavaScript richiede download, parsing ed esecuzione, tutti processi che bloccano il thread principale.

Server-side rendering e static generation

SSR (Server-Side Rendering) e SSG (Static Site Generation) migliorano significativamente il First Contentful Paint generando HTML sul server. Framework come Next.js, Nuxt e Gatsby implementano questi pattern, offrendo il meglio di mondi dinamici e statici.

Migliorare la velocità del sito richiede approccio metodico e attenzione continua, ma i benefici in termini di esperienza utente, conversioni e posizionamento SEO giustificano ampiamente l'investimento. Se stai cercando supporto per ottimizzare le performance del tuo sito o per realizzare un progetto web veloce e strategico fin dall'inizio, Leone Finzi può aiutarti a creare esperienze digitali coinvolgenti che valorizzano l'unicità della tua attività, combinando design attraente e prestazioni tecniche ottimali.

Ti è stato utile? Condividilo!
Ciao! Sono Leone Finzi, web designer e sviluppatore freelance. Progetto siti web per aziende e professionisti